Reviewed 6 November 2022 via mobile

We arrived at the hotel around 1:30pm & were lucky to bag a car parking space. £15 charge for 24 hours, know £12 at the multi storey further down the road but prefer not to have the 5 minute walk.

We were then also lucky that our room was ready. We’d booked a river view & when we walked into the room were not disappointed. You can tell it’s a fairly new hotel & everything was quite modern. We stayed on the 3rd floor & my heart sank a bit as we the room directly opposite the lift. However I never heard any noise from the lift overnight so was not a problem in the end.

The bed & pillows was so comfy & had a great nights sleep. The free mini bar was also much appreciated for the soft drinks.

If I had to mark the hotel alone it would’ve been 5 out of 5 but sadly we had the misfortune of making the mistake of having a drink in the bar. This is what soured the whole stay for me.

We sat down in the bar area & I had a look at the drinks menu. Yes they were overpriced already but I chose to have a large Pinot Grigio £10. The hubby a pint of Morretti £5.95. My husband went to the bar & got the drinks & then brought them back himself to our table. My Barclays App told me we’d just paid £17.55. My husband at the time didn’t question it but I went straight back to the bar & questioned why we’d been overcharged. Cue a very stubborn bar maid having a face off with me saying my husband had accepted (unknowingly) a 10% service charge for getting 2 drinks from the bar!!! He’d gone to the bar HIMSELF and delivered them to our table HIMSELF!! Where’s the service charge in that??? I said to her in all of the times we’ve stayed in hotels I’d NEVER known a service charge for getting a drink in a bar?? I challenged this charge & then she was fishing around in the bin trying to find my receipt. She wouldn’t back down on this & didn’t offer to refund me at any time. I went back to drink my now £11 glass of wine (£1 for pouring it for me)…. It stuck in my throat. When you can see Wetherspoons literally 10 steps away DON’T BOTHER drinking in this hotel bar.

I did mention this at check out & as the hotel & restaurant are supposedly separate but in the same building they can’t do anything. They did offer to sort a refund but I didn’t have my receipt as the bar maid couldn’t find my receipt in her bin the night before……

Nowhere on the drinks menu did it mention a service charge!!

I would stay at the hotel again but will not ever frequent Gino Decampo’s bar or restaurant ever again.

Room tip: Avoid the hotel bar
